bludg·eon  audio  (bljn) KEY 

NOUN:
A short heavy club, usually of wood, that is thicker or loaded at one end.
TRANSITIVE VERB:
bludg·eoned, bludg·eon·ing, bludg·eons
  1. To hit with or as if with a heavy club.
  2. To overcome by or as if by using a heavy club. See Synonyms at intimidate.

ETYMOLOGY:
Origin unknown

OTHER FORMS:
bludgeon·er or bludgeon·eer  (--nîr) KEY (Noun)
